#d45321 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d45321 is composed of 83.1% red, 32.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 16.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 48%. #d45321 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a642 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d45321 color description : Strong orange.

#d45321 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d45321 has RGB values of R:212, G:83,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.84,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13914913.

Shades and Tints of #d45321

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d45321

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7876 is the less saturated color, while #f04705 is the most saturated one.
